Fig. 9 shows the results regarding titration of virus yields and of cell proliferation on the 3rd day after infection, which is the day of maximum virus yield in our experimental conditions. Distamycin-A, even at cytotoxic doses, poorly inhibited the virus replication distamycin-4 was very active on virus replication and distamycin-5 at non-cytotoxic doses was able to reduce viral yields by 92.3%. [Pg.111]
